Subject: [PATCH v2 1/3] dt-bindings: net: pse-pd: add poll-interval-ms property
Date: Mon, 23 Mar 2026 21:12:23 +0100 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20260323201225.1836561-2-github@szelinsky.de>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20260323201225.1836561-1-github@szelinsky.de>
Add the optional poll-interval-ms property for PSE controllers that
use poll-based event detection instead of interrupts. Defaults to
500ms if not specified.

diff --git a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/pse-pd/pse-controller.yaml b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/pse-pd/pse-controller.yaml
index cd09560e0aea..329d020f054c 100644
--- a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/pse-pd/pse-controller.yaml
+++ b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/pse-pd/pse-controller.yaml
@@ -27,6 +27,14 @@ properties:
subnode. This property is deprecated, please use pse-pis instead.
enum: [0, 1]
+ poll-interval-ms:
+ description:
+ Polling interval in milliseconds for PSE controllers using
+ poll-based event detection instead of interrupts. Used when the
+ controller lacks IRQ support or the IRQ line is not wired.
+ default: 500
+ minimum: 50
+
